DOI QR코드

DOI QR Code

An Encryption Algorithm Based on Light-Weight SEED for Accessing Multiple Objects in RFID System

RFID 시스템에서 다중 객체를 지원하기 위한 경량화된 SEED 기반의 암호화 알고리즘

  • Received : 2010.08.12
  • Accepted : 2010.09.03
  • Published : 2010.09.30

Abstract

Recently, RFID systems are spreading in various industrial areas faster but cause some serious problems of information security because of its unstable wireless communication. Moreover, traditional RFID systems have a restriction that one tag per each application object. This restriction deteriorates their usability because it is difficult to distinguish many tags without some kind of effort. Therefore, efficient information sharing of objects based on information security has to be studied for more spreading of RFID technologies. In this paper, we design a new RFID tag structure for supporting multiple objects which can be shared by many different RFID applications. We also design an encryption/decryption algorithm to protect the identifying information of objects stored in our tag structure. This algorithm is a light revision of the existing SEED algorithm which can be operated in RFID tag environment. To evaluate the performance of our algorithm, we measure the encryption and decryption times of this algorithm and compare the results with those of the original SEED algorithm.

최근 RFID 시스템은 응용 범위를 넓혀가고 있으나 무선 통신의 불안전한 특성으로 인한 정보 보안 문제 및 응용 객체별 별도 태그 사용에 의한 불편함 등의 문제점들을 내포하고 있다. 따라서 RFID 기술을 응용한 시스템의 확산을 위해서는 안정적인 정보 보호를 바탕으로 한 여러 응용 객체들 간의 효율적인 정보 공유에 대한 연구가 마련되어야 한다. 본 논문에서는 하나의 태그로 다수 개의 RFID 응용 객체들에 접근할 수 있도록 하는 다중 객체 접근을 위한 RFID 태그 구조를 설계하고, 이러한 태그 내에 저장되는 각 응용 객체에 대한 정보를 보호하기 위한 암호화 알고리즘을 제안한다. 제안하는 알고리즘은 기존의 암호화 기법인 SEED 알고리즘을 RFID 시스템의 특성에 맞도록 경량화한 방법이다. 태그 정보를 보호하기 위한 SEED 변형 알고리즘의 성능은 암 복호화의 속도를 측정하여 기존의 SEED 알고리즘과 비교하여 평가한다.

Keywords

References

  1. G. Avoine, and P. Oechslin, "RFID Traceability: A Multilayer Problem," EPFL, 2004
  2. K. Finkenzeller, "RFID Handbook," John Wiley & Sons, 1999.
  3. S. E. Sarma, S. A Weis, and D. W. Engels, "RFID Systems and Security and Privacy Implications", Workshop on Cryptographic Hardware and Embedded Systems, 2002.
  4. S. S. Yeo and S. K Kim, "Scalable and Flexible Privacy Protection Scheme for RFID System," Proc. the 2nd European Workshop on Security and Privacy in Adhoc and Sensor Networks (ESAS2005), LNCS 3813, pp.153-163, 2005.
  5. S. E. Sarma, "Towards the Fivecent tag," MIT AutoID Center, 2002.
  6. A. Juels, and R. Pappu, "Squealing Euros: Privacy Protetction in RFID-Enabled Banknotes", FC'03, LNCS 2742, pp.103-121, 2003.
  7. A. J. Elbirt, W. Yip, B. Chetwynd, and C. Parr, "An FPGA-based Performance Evaluation of the AES Block Cipher Candidate Algorithm Finalists," IEEE Transactions on Very Large Scale Integration System, vol. 9, no. 4, 2001.
  8. M. Feldhofer, S. Dominikus, and J. Wolkerstorfer, "Strong Authentication for RFID Systems Using the AES Algorithm, "Workshop on Cryptographic Hardware and Embedded Systems, LNCS 3156, pp.357 - 370, 2004.
  9. 최병윤, "AES Rijndael 암호 프로세서의 설계, "한국통신학회논문지, vol. 26, no. 10B, pp.1491-1500, 2001.
  10. 한국정보보호진흥원, "128비트 블록 암호 알고리즘(SEED) 개발 및 분석 보고서," 2003.
  11. 김지연, 정종진, 조근식, 이균하, 다중 객체 지원을 위한 RFID 시스템에서 보안 레벨 기반의 인증 기법에 관한 연구, 한국전자거래학회논문지, 13권 호1, pp.22-32, 2008. 2.
  12. H. Y. Park, B. Y. Sohn, and Y. T. Shin, "Safe Authentication Method for Security Communication in Ubiquitous Environment," IICSA 2005 LNCS, pp.442-448, 2005.